So obviously I dont have a high end comp or a low end comp so its more than recommend to play this game at high settings but I can not for some reason can only play on Med settings (Thats ALL No boxes checked besides fullscreen) Max settings are to hard on the FPS For me to fully enjoy it but im still testing and seeing whats the best. Also thanks to the TQ:IT Fan Patch has helped these tests a whole lot more! Thanks you Guys!



Purpose for testing:
Testing to see if having your desktop set to your native screen and at it highest Refresh rate
(My Native 1680x1050 MAX RES. 60 Hz)
or
Testing to see if having your desktop set to a Resolution with a higher Refresh Rate
(Resolution 1440x900 MAX RES. 75 Hz)
and
Testing to see what resolutions work best with playing TQ:IT With the most recent Fan Patch
Note:
Testing only at the begginning of the path to Typhon then to the stairs right before Typhon (LOL My char elementalist lvl 34 has a hard time killing him, but I do kill him but it takes like 30 mins!)



2008-08-09 17:10:00 - Tqit 1680X1050 Med Set. (Desktop 1680x1050 60Hz)
Frames: 12739 - Time: 224258ms - Avg: 56.805 - Min: 30 - Max: 84

2008-08-09 17:16:59 - Tqit 1680x1050 Med Set. (Desktop 1440x900 75Hz)
Frames: 13422 - Time: 232011ms - Avg: 57.851 - Min: 29 - Max: 79

2008-08-09 17:26:45 - Tqit 1600x900 Med Set. (Desktop 1680x1050 60Hz)
Frames: 11647 - Time: 200118ms - Avg: 58.201 - Min: 35 - Max: 79

2008-08-09 17:33:04 - Tqit 1600x900 Med Set. (Desktop 1440x900 75Hz)
Frames: 12123 - Time: 202353ms - Avg: 59.910 - Min: 33 - Max: 90

2008-08-09 17:38:48 - Tqit 1440x900 Med Set. (Desktop 1680x1050 60Hz)
Frames: 11632 - Time: 195164ms - Avg: 59.601 - Min: 34 - Max: 94

2008-08-09 17:50:15 - Tqit 1440x900 Med Set. (Desktop 1440x900 75Hz)
Frames: 10097 - Time: 179493ms - Avg: 56.253 - Min: 24 - Max: 87

**2008-08-09 17:55:58 - Tqit 1400x1050 Med Set. (Desktop 1680x1050 60Hz)**
Frames: 11809 - Time: 192712ms - Avg: 61.278 - Min: 35 - Max: 97

2008-08-09 18:02:38 - Tqit 1400x1050 Med Set. (Desktop 1440x900 75Hz)
Frames: 10611 - Time: 177154ms - Avg: 59.897 - Min: 32 - Max: 95

2008-08-09 18:09:40 - Tqit 1280x960 Med Set. (Dekstop 1680x1050 60Hz)
Frames: 12905 - Time: 204465ms - Avg: 63.116 - Min: 30 - Max: 93

2008-08-09 18:15:20 - Tqit 1280x960 Med Set. (Desktop 1440x900 75Hz)
Frames: 11543 - Time: 188067ms - Avg: 61.377 - Min: 31 - Max: 96

2008-08-09 18:21:35 - Tqit 1152x864 Med Set. (Desktop 1680x1050 60Hz)
Frames: 10373 - Time: 170048ms - Avg: 61.000 - Min: 32 - Max: 94

2008-08-09 18:26:51 - Tqit 1152x864 Med Set. (Desktop 1440x900 75Hz)
Frames: 14503 - Time: 226893ms - Avg: 63.920 - Min: 26 - Max: 95


**This was the best setting for me. IMO it has great AVG, MIN, and MAX**

A better video card will help tons as far as the lag.

I started playing this game on a 6800GT, upgraded to a 7600 for a day (wasn't powerful enough), then settled on a 7800GS. That card failed within a month so I upgraded again to a 7950GT. That was a while back. You're CPU is ok, RAM is sufficient but the card is very dated. You can pick up a 8800GT for around $ 150 - 180 now and that will allow you to turn all in game settings to max at the native resolution with no lag or stuttering.
